CHOOSING THE RIGHT HERMETIC SEAL FOR YOUR AUTOMOTIVE AND ELECTRIC OR HYDROGEN POWERED VEHICLE APPLICATIONS

In the rapidly evolving landscape of the automotive industry, selecting the appropriate hermetically sealed connectors for both traditional and electric vehicles is crucial to ensure efficiency, safety, and performance. Hermetic seals provide airtight barriers, making them essential for maintaining optimal operating conditions and preventing contamination or moisture ingress. As both consumers and manufacturers push for increased reliability and longevity, the pressure to choose the right materials and designs for these seals is greater than ever.

Technological Advancements

Technological advancements in materials have allowed for more robust and durable hermetic seals, capable of standing up to the unique demands of modern vehicles. These seals must withstand a range of temperatures, pressures, and chemical exposures under intense operating conditions. Electric Vehicles

The rise of electric vehicles (EVs) presents a unique set of challenges and requirements for hermetically sealed connectors. In EVs, components such as batteries and high-voltage systems are particularly sensitive to environmental factors. Hermetic seals in these systems play a pivotal role in ensuring safety by preventing the ingress of dust, water, and other contaminants that might compromise electrical components and battery efficiency. Additionally, these seals help in maintaining the optimal temperature necessary for battery longevity and vehicle reliability.

Carbon Footprint

Cost-efficiency and sustainability are also driving forces in the selection process for hermetic seals. As automotive companies continue to prioritize eco-friendly operations, the materials and manufacturing processes for these seals are being scrutinized for their environmental impact. Manufacturers are increasingly opting for seals designed from sustainably sourced materials or utilizing manufacturing processes with a lower carbon footprint, all while ensuring that the seal’s performance does not wane under the demands of high-efficiency vehicles.

The choice of hermetically sealed connectors in automotive and electric vehicle applications is more critical than ever, given the industry’s push towards efficiency, safety, and sustainability. Selecting the right type of seal not only ensures operational reliability but also enhances the vehicle’s performance and longevity. As technology continues to advance, these seals will play an indispensable role in defining the future of automotive engineering including in the use of hydrogen powered vehicles.
